Problem Statement

Let AA be a 3×93 \times 9 matrix. All elements of AA are positive integers. We call an m×nm\times n submatrix of AA "ox" if the sum of its elements is divisible by 1010, and we call an element of AA "carboxylic" if it is not an element of any "ox" submatrix. Find the largest possible number of "carboxylic" elements in AA.
